ABOUT THE PROGRAM
Audible’s “Next Chapter” Returnship Program is a paid full-time internship for experienced professionals returning to the workforce after taking time off for caregiving. The program is open to professionals who have at least 5 years of professional experience and have been out of the paid workforce for at least one year to focus on caring for a child or other dependent. If you meet these criteria, we welcome you to apply. This program offers you a chance to revamp your skills, update your resume with new experiences, and make connections with other professionals.
ABOUT THIS ROLE
As a Quality Assurance Engineer, you'll play a critical role in defining the testing strategy and architecture that ensures the continued quality and reliability of our data, marketing technology, and AI-powered systems. You'll own the full testing lifecycle - from designing functional and performance test suites to implementing test automation frameworks and delivering high-quality software on tight schedules.

As a Quality Assurance Engineer, you will...
- Help define the QA strategy and select appropriate tools to support the engineering teams working on data, marketing technology, or artificial intelligence systems
- Own the full test lifecycle for large-scale systems across web, mobile web, and native applications
- Deliver test automation, quality requirements, functional and performance test suites, and high-quality software deliverables
- Contribute to the architecture of test automation solutions, identify limitations, and develop major routines and utilities
- Generate metrics and insights that drive continuous improvement in development practices
- Review technical requirements, software design specs, and implementation to ensure quality
- Establish best practices for test automation, frameworks, and documentation
- Take advantage of resources and training to stay up-to-date on tools, trends, and technologies, and share that knowledge with the team

Basic Qualifications
- Experience owning the full test strategy through test completion for components of a software system
- Experience in writing queries to validate data against backend databases
- Hands on experience with test automation using a programming or scripting language
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ience with web and mobile testing
- Experience working with Agile methodologies
- Proficient in a broad range of data structures and algorithms, knowing when it is (and isn't) appropriate to use them
- 1+ years of experience contributing to the architecture and design (architecture, design patterns, reliability and scaling) of test automation solutions
- Ability to triage issues, react well to changes, and collaborate effectively with other test and development teams
- Strong communication skills - ability to provide information to technical and non-technical stakeholders alike and guide them to confidently informed decisions
